Our client has recently brought a home in Hertford where Japanese knotweed was present. The previous owner had a Herbicide treatment programme in place with ourselves that was keeping the Japanese knotweed under control. The new homeowner is looking to build a home office at the rear of the garden which would mean complete excavation of the Japanese knotweed.

We discussed with the client the possibility of a dig and dump or screening and together we decided screening would be the most cost effective and efficient solution.

The Japanese knotweed area was excavated using small plant machinery and placed onto a biosecurity barrier. Our technicians then manually screened the soil using a small electric powered trommel screener to remove all traces of knotweed rhizomes and material. The rhizomes and material were then placed in secure dumpy bags for onward transportation to a licensed landfill transfer station under EPA 1990 Duty of Care Guidelines. The cleaned soils were reinstated in the voids.

INSURANCE BACKED GUARANTEES (IBG’S)

Knotweed Services UK offer their insurance backed guarantees through Guarantee Protection Insurance Ltd (Accelerant Insurance UK Limited). Accelerant Insurance UK Limiteds primary and founding product was IBG’s and they are in the industries leaders in Japanese Knotweed insurance. The package we recommended for this project is the is “designed to provide cover in the event that the insured remedial works fail, during the period of insurance, and the contractor has ceased to trade and is unable to honour claims on the written guarantee.” (Accelerant Insurance UK Limited, 2017).

*Taking out an IBG is optional. However, if you are in the process of selling, an IBG is a requirement from the mortgage lenders.
